This week we have continued our exploration of our solar system and we have been amazed at just how much the children have grasped and remembered about our universe! 
This has led to some great imaginative play in art and small world and the children have been able to make and create using different materials, gaining valuable practice using joiners such as glue and sellotape developing those all important fine motor skills.

Outside they have been practising balancing on the beams at various heights and lots more practise of this when you are out and about at the parks or playgrounds will really help develop your child’s confidence in this area. We find that children recognise their own limitations and will not do something that is beyond their capabilities. Our job is to allow them to explore and try taking these risks to maximise the feeling of pride when they accomplish something they once found difficult.

We are developing their awareness of a ‘set’ through sorting activities in maths and doing lots of practical counting.

We have been using lots of language to explore textures and observe changes by making moon sand and space slime and the children really enjoyed this.
